Des Tourelles Claret Bordeaux

Des Tourelles Claret Bordeaux

Steeped in Tradition. The name Claret comes from the French term ‘clairet,’ used in 14th century England to describe a rosé wine from Bordeaux. Des Tourelles Claret Bordeaux is a reflection of the contemporary style of red wine rather than the less robust rosé of centuries past. Claret is mostly used as an unofficial name…

Léon Perdigal Lirac 2021

Léon Perdigal Lirac 2021

Intense Red. Lirac is found in the southern Rhône valley. It is located on the opposite side of the Rhône River to Châteauneuf-du-Pape. Wines here represent better value for money since the region is not as well-known as its more celebrated neighbour. Léon Perdigal Lirac is a good example of wines from this region. The…
